"""
    SoftLayer.tests.CLI.modules.ticket_tests
    ~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
    :license: MIT, see LICENSE for more details.
"""
import json
from unittest import mock as mock

from SoftLayer.CLI import exceptions
from SoftLayer.CLI import formatting
from SoftLayer.CLI import ticket
from SoftLayer.managers import TicketManager
from SoftLayer import testing


class FakeTTY():
    """A fake object to fake STD input"""

    def __init__(self, isatty=False, read="Default Output"):
        """Sets isatty and read"""
        self._isatty = isatty
        self._read = read

    def isatty(self):
        """returns self.isatty"""
        return self._isatty

    def read(self):
        """returns self.read"""
        return self._read


class TicketTests(testing.TestCase):

    def test_list(self):
        result = self.run_command(['ticket', 'list'])

        expected = [{
            'assigned_user': 'John Smith',
            'Case_Number': 'CS123456',
            'id': 102,
            'last_edited': '2013-08-01',
            'priority': 0,
            'status': 'Open',
            'title': 'Cloud Instance Cancellation - 08/01/13',
            'updates': 0}]
        self.assert_no_fail(result)
        self.assertEqual(expected, json.loads(result.output))
